Xiàn
Pronunciation: shyen
Meaning
various meanings depending on characters, e.g., 'to appear', 'to offer', 'virtuous'
Origin
Chinese
About Xiàn
Xiàn, a name steeped in the rich heritage of Mandarin Chinese, carries a profound sense of tradition and depth. Its beauty lies in its versatility, as its meaning shifts gracefully depending on the specific character used, encompassing concepts from 'to appear' and 'to offer' to the admirable 'virtuous'. This makes Xiàn a thoughtful choice for parents who appreciate a name with inherent flexibility and a connection to ancient cultural roots, yet one that remains perfectly at home in the modern world. Unlike many names with multiple meanings, Xiàn’s various interpretations all lean towards positive, evocative qualities, offering a subtle strength and grace.
